以文本方式查看主题 - Foxtable(狐表) (http://foxtable.net/bbs/index.asp) -- 专家坐堂 (http://foxtable.net/bbs/list.asp?boardid=2) ---- [求助关于周报审核数据 (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=46212) |
||||
-- 作者:lhlxl -- 发布时间:2014/2/19 10:25:00 -- [求助关于周报审核数据 周报制度 实现功能:每周星期六要求固定人员上报数据,下周任何日期由管理人员进行审核。软件自动识别出上周六没有提交数据的人员,并记录。 本人设计思路:当管理者打开软件时 软件代码算出当天为星期几(DayOfWeek),并用当前日期减去算出的星期数,筛选得到日期值得数据;如果发现固定人员在这个日期没有上报数据,就记录一次该人员违规。 问题疑惑:如果管理人员间隔一周以上时间,我的上面设计思路就不正确了。因为上面只是计算审核当日最近一周的数据,不能计算出超出一周的数据是否有人没有上报数据。 请各位大大指点一下,帮助我完善思路。 |
||||
-- 作者:Bin -- 发布时间:2014/2/19 10:28:00 -- 不是有日期记录的吗,超过一周怎么就没办法判断了. 超100年都可以判断啊. |
||||
-- 作者:Bin -- 发布时间:2014/2/19 10:28:00 -- 你上个例子我瞅瞅你是怎么做的,如果有记录到日期,判断一下日期不就好了. |
||||
-- 作者:lhlxl -- 发布时间:2014/2/19 10:30:00 -- 上报数据 是有上报日期作为记录的。 我可能没有明白记录日期的作用。 能否帮我讲一下呢。
|
||||
-- 作者:lhlxl -- 发布时间:2014/2/19 10:42:00 -- 斑竹能否说一下你的设计思路么 |
||||
-- 作者:lsy -- 发布时间:2014/2/19 10:43:00 -- 日期列的作用很大,如果非常精确,甚至都可以当唯一编号值用。 |
||||
-- 作者:Bin -- 发布时间:2014/2/19 10:43:00 -- 如果日期超过了15天,你觉得这个会是一个星期还是2个星期? 怎么会无法判断呢? |
||||
-- 作者:lhlxl -- 发布时间:2014/2/19 10:47:00 -- 上面的代码我都可以写出来 问题就出现在我的设计思路上 我没有想明白 如果管理者超出一周时间进行审核时 就无法对上一周的上报数据者的数据进行审核了 上面代码只是对当前日期最近一周的数据进行审核 我想求助有经验的给点思路
|
||||
-- 作者:Bin -- 发布时间:2014/2/19 10:49:00 -- 我没有办法说得更明白了,你上例子吧. 纸上不谈兵! |
||||
-- 作者:lhlxl -- 发布时间:2014/2/19 12:13:00 -- 请斑竹帮助一下
[此贴子已经被作者于2014-2-19 12:14:22编辑过]
|